achieved through description, thoughts, words, actions, and reactions of characters
What is characterization?

This is literary device that always tells a story
What is a narrative?

A figure of speech in which an object or animal is given human feelings, thoughts, or attitudes
What is personification?

story told from the "he, she, they" point of view
What is third person?

the use of hints and clues to suggest what will happen later in a plot
What is foreshadowing?

Most exciting moment of the story; turning point
What is climax?

the feeling created in the reader by a literary work or passage
What is mood?

the perspective from which a story is told
What is point of view?

a generalization that is used to characterize a person without acknowledging individual differences
What is stereotype?

a struggle between opposing needs, desires, or emotions within a single character
What is internal conflict?

the struggle between opposing forces
What is conflict?

logical conclusion based on observations
What is inference?

The time and place of a literary work
What is setting?

Anything that stands for or represents something else
What is symbol?

a comparison not using like or as, as in "her eyes are a blue sea."
What is metaphor

put in opposition to show or emphasize differences
What is contrast?

the writer reveals information about a character and his personality through that character's thought, words, and actions
What is indirect characterization?

theme The main idea or meaning of a text. Often, this is an insight (a nugget of truth) about human life revealed in a literary work
What is theme?

excited anticipation of an approaching climax
What is suspense?

a scene or event from the past that appears in a narrative out of chronological order, to fill in information or explain something in the present
What is a flashback?

examine and note similarities
What is compare?

a type, class, or category, especially of fine art or literature
What is genre?

using words that imitate the sound they denote
What is onomatopoeia

the opposite of what is expected
What is irony?
